Controls Engineer

Location: Sandusky, Ohio area

PLC Programming & Code Development

  • Develop, modify, and maintain PLC code—primarily Allen-Bradley (AB), with increasing work on Siemens, Omron, and Mitsubishi platforms.
  • Create, update, and document control logic for new equipment and system upgrades.

System Commissioning & Debug

  • Perform on-site commissioning, startup, and debug of automated systems.
  • Troubleshoot control systems during build, launch, and production support phases.
  • Provide periodic off-shift or weekend support depending on project needs.

HMI Development

  • Develop and modify HMI screens using AB PanelView, Weintek, and C-more interfaces.

Robotics Integration

  • Program, integrate, and troubleshoot robots—primarily Fanuc and Yaskawa, with exposure to ABB and Kuka as needed.

Automation & Auxiliary Systems

  • Integrate and support:
  • Vision systems (Keyence, Sick)
  • RFID systems
  • Safety devices (area scanners, light curtains, safety controllers)
  • I/O Link devices

Technical Documentation & Support

  • Create electrical and controls documentation (schematics, layouts, IO lists, etc.).
  • Provide support to maintenance, operations, and cross-functional engineering teams.
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ards and industry best practices.

Required Qualifications

  • 3–7 years of experience as a PLC, Controls, or Automation Engineer.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in Allen-Bradley RSLogix/Studio 5000 .
  • Experience with at least one of the following: Siemens (TIA Portal), Omron, Mitsubishi .
  • Hands-on experience with controls commissioning , startup, and debug.
  • Experience programming or integrating industrial robots (Fanuc, Yaskawa, ABB, or Kuka).
  • Working knowledge of vision systems , safety devices , and industrial networking.
  •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ics and machine drawings.
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
  • Willingness to provide off-shift support when required.
